Gambogic Acid Blocks Proliferation And Induces Apoptosis Of Lung Ddenocarcinom A549 Cells Through Downergulation Of STAT3

Objective: To investigate the effect of Gambogic acid on the proliferation and apoptosis of lung cancer A549 cells, and to explore its effect on regulation of STAT3.Methods: MTT assay and flow cytomerty were used to detect the growth inhibition and apoptosis of A549 cells induced by different concentrations of GA. Cell morphological change was observed by microscope.The localization of STAT3 and the expression was determined by confocal laser scanning microscopy.STAT3 mRNA expression was determined by RT-PCR and protein level of STAT3 was revealed by western blot analysis.Results: The results indicated that GA could inhibit the proliferation of the A549 cells significantly and promote apoptosis in a time and dose dependent manner.After treatment with GA for 24h,48h,72h,the IC50 value were (2.81±0.28)umol /L,(1.86±0.01) umol /L and (1.35±0.10)umol/L respectively. Further confirmed by flow cytometry, when 1.5umol/L and 3umol/L of GA were given to the A549 cells for 24h, the apoptotic rates were (24.38±1.42)%, (51.60±3.23)% respectively.The apoptosis rate is (77.09±1.44)% when the concentration of GA was up to 6umol/L.Over expression of STAT3 was found in A549 cells,and was situated mainly in the cytoplasm. Cell morphological change was observed by microscope. In the control group,the cells with round caryon were polygon, thin and flat, and they were fast clingy. In the GA treated groups,with the increase of drug concentration,the cells showed a typical morphological changes of apoptosis, the cells became contracted and poor at clingy;disappear of the ecphyma of the cells, and chromatin condensation.The expression of STAT3 mRNA and STAT3 protein were downregulated in A549 cells treated with GA in a concentration dependent manner. Conclusion: GA can inhibit the growth and promote the apoptosis of human lung adenocarcinoma A549 cells,The molecular mechanism may be due to the downregulating expressions of STAT3.
